Output 2d3414bc364ef2e266ff562be96f78b710c15486f5ed84f6ba87a05bbc77817f:1

value
57403615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d41dd3fd6cfe1aa33782de39dc639a4c97ab37d OP_EQUAL
address
3G2WuzN1VGhwwvfNgYLG9fXSez58Zrhn6g
transaction
2d3414bc364ef2e266ff562be96f78b710c15486f5ed84f6ba87a05bbc77817f
spent
true